Div Com Kashmir Reviews Major Road Projects, Orders Fresh Study on Srinagar Ring Road Alignment

High-Level Meeting Discusses Parimpora–Dalgate & Panthachowk Flyovers; Committee Formed to Assess Impact, NHAI Asked to Minimise Effect on Residential Areas

Srinagar, July 30 (JKNS): Divisional Commissioner Kashmir, Anshul Garg, on Tgursday chaired a high-level meeting to review the alignment and implementation of key road infrastructure projects, including the Parimpora–Dalgate Flyover, Panthachowk Flyover and the Srinagar Ring Road stretch from Panthachowk to Pandach, directing concerned agencies to expedite planning while ensuring minimal impact on residential areas and public infrastructure.

Div Com Garg, as per news agency JKNS, chaired a high-level meeting of key stakeholder departments to deliberate on the alignment and implementation of major road infrastructure projects, including the Parimpora–Dalgate Flyover, Panthachowk Flyover, and the Srinagar Ring Road stretch from Panthachowk to Pandach.

The meeting was attended by the Chief Conservator Forests, Deputy Commissioner Srinagar, Commissioner Srinagar Municipal Corporation, Vice Chairman Srinagar Development Authority, Director Airport Authority, Senior Superintendent of Police (Traffic) Srinagar, Chief Engineers of KPDCL and Irrigation & Flood Control, along with senior officers from the Roads & Buildings Department, RTO, UEED, LCMA, Air Force, National Highways Authority of India (NHAI), BSF, and other concerned departments.

A threadbare deliberation was conducted on the proposed Parimpora–Dalgate Flyover, with discussions focusing on its alignment, project cost, anticipated impact on traffic flow, and implications for existing city utilities.

It was decided to constitute a committee comprising officers from the stakeholder departments to undertake a comprehensive assessment of the project’s impact and submit recommendations.
The meeting also discussed construction of the two parts of the Panthachowk–Pandrethan Flyover and decided to move ahead with the execution of the project.

With regard to the Panthachowk–Pandach section of the Srinagar Ring Road, the meeting decided to undertake a fresh study of the proposed alignments to minimise the impact on residential areas.

NHAI officials were directed to carry out a comparative evaluation of the suggested alignments and submit recommendations for the most suitable option.

Earlier, the meeting also discussed the proposed road from Ring Road Part-I via Sheikhpora to Airport Road and its potential impact on adjacent BSF security establishments.

On the occasion, the Divisional Commissioner directed officers of the Air Force and BSF to hold joint consultations with the executing agency to explore a feasible solution that addresses the concerns of all stakeholder departments while ensuring timely implementation of the project. (JKNS)
